Game Recap: Women's Basketball |

Ten Different Players Score For Eagles In Loss To Philadelphia

Waterbury, Conn. - The Post University women's basketball team lost a Central Atlantic Collegiate Conference game to South Division leader, Philadelphia on Friday afternoon, 87-42 at the Drubner Center.

Three players, juniors Jovan Kingwood (Norwich, Conn.) and Tyra Jones (Rochester, N.Y.) and sophomore Lexus Childs-Harris led the Eagles (0-18, 0-9, CACC) with seven points apiece. 

The Rams (15-5, 11-0 CACC) jumped out to a 19-4 lead after the first quarter and extended their lead to 47-16 at halftime before putting the game away in the second half.

Bria Young led the Rams with 17 points. Tori Arnao had a double-double, scoring 16 points and grabbing 12 rebounds for the Rams.

The Eagles got the edge in fastbreak points, 8-6 and spread the ball around as 10 players scored for them during the game.

Up next for the Eagles is a road CACC contest against Caldwell on January 26 at 6 p.m.
